    iterm2 update, moving the shit out of the core application (like it probably shouldā€™ve been in the first place):

    3.5.1
    
    This release adds some safety valves to eliminate
    the risk of private information leaving the
    terminal via the AI endpoints. While an API key
    and explicit user action were always needed to use
    AI features, some users asked for an impenetrable
    firewall for safety and regulatory purposes.
    
    To that end, there are three relevant changes:
    
    1. Code that communicates with AI providers such
    as OpenAI has been moved into a plugin that you
    must install separately. Enterprise system admins
    can block bundle id com.googlecode.iterm2.iTermAI
    to prevent it from being installed in the first
    place.
    
    See here for details:
    https://iterm2.com/ai-plugin.html
    
    2. In addition, you must manually enable AI
    features in Settings. Doing so requires admin
    access.
    
    3. Enterprise administrators who wish to disable
    iTerm2's AI access may set the user default
    GenerativeAIAllowed to False in their MDM systems.
